.wp-block-acf-numbered-features{--color-bg:color-mix(in srgb,var(--wp--preset--color--primary) 10%,#fff);--border-radius:max(0.5rem,calc(var(--wp--custom--border-radius) * 5));--number-size:clamp(3.5rem,8vw,6rem);--padding-y:clamp(1.5rem,4vw,2.5rem);--padding-x:clamp(1.5rem,4vw,2.5rem)}.wp-block-acf-numbered-features.acf-block-preview *{pointer-events:none}.wp-block-acf-numbered-features .items{list-style:none;counter-reset:features-count}.wp-block-acf-numbered-features .items:has(.fade-ready){overflow:hidden}.wp-block-acf-numbered-features .item{counter-increment:features-count}.wp-block-acf-numbered-features .item .image img{vertical-align:middle}.wp-block-acf-numbered-features.is-style-default .items,.wp-block-acf-numbered-features:not([class*=is-style-]) .items{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;row-gap:calc(var(--number-size) / 2 + clamp(1rem, 4vw, 3rem));margin:0;padding:calc(var(--number-size) / 2) 0 0;list-style:none}.wp-block-acf-numbered-features.is-style-default .item,.wp-block-acf-numbered-features:not([class*=is-style-]) .item{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;padding-right:var(--wp--style--root--padding-right);padding-left:var(--wp--style--root--padding-left);background-size:cover}.wp-block-acf-numbered-features.is-style-default .item .wrapper,.wp-block-acf-numbered-features:not([class*=is-style-]) .item .wrapper{position:relative;width: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.wp-block-acf-numbered-features.is-style-default .item .content,.wp-block-acf-numbered-features:not([class*=is-style-]) .item .content{-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;row-gap:clamp(1.3rem,3vw,1.8rem);padding:var(--padding-y) var(--padding-x);background-color:var(--color-bg);border-bottom-left-radius:var(--border-radius);border-bottom-right-radius:var(--border-radius)}.wp-block-acf-numbered-features.is-style-default .item .content:before,.wp-block-acf-numbered-features:not([class*=is-style-]) .item .content:before{content:counter(features-count,decimal-leading-zero);display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;font-family:"Libre Baskerville","Aboreto","Noto Serif JP",sans-serif;position:absolute;top:0;left:50%;padding:0 clamp(1rem,3vw,2rem);font-size:var(--number-size);font-weight:normal;color:var(--wp--preset--color--primary);line-height:1;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);text-shadow:0 0 0.5rem rgba(255,255,255,0.8)}.wp-block-acf-numbered-features.is-style-default .item .content .title,.wp-block-acf-numbered-features:not([class*=is-style-]) .item .content .title{margin:0;font-size:clamp(1.2rem,2vw,1.8rem);color:var(--wp--preset--color--primary)}.wp-block-acf-numbered-features.is-style-default .item .image,.wp-block-acf-numbered-features:not([class*=is-style-]) .item .image{-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1}.wp-block-acf-numbered-features.is-style-default .item .image img,.wp-block-acf-numbered-features:not([class*=is-style-]) .item .image img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;border-top-left-radius:var(--border-radius);border-top-right-radius:var(--border-radius)}@media screen and (min-width:851px){.wp-block-acf-numbered-features.is-style-default .item .wrapper,.wp-block-acf-numbered-features:not([class*=is-style-]) .item .wrapper{max-width:var(--wp--style--global--wide-size);display:-ms-grid;display:grid;-ms-grid-columns:(minmax(0,1fr))[2];grid-template-columns:repeat(2,minmax(0,1fr));border-radius:0}.wp-block-acf-numbered-features.is-style-default .item .content,.wp-block-acf-numbered-features:not([class*=is-style-]) .item .content{position:relative;border-radius:0;background-color:transparent}.wp-block-acf-numbered-features.is-style-default .item .content:before,.wp-block-acf-numbered-features:not([class*=is-style-]) .item .content:before{position:relative;top:0;left:0;margin-top:calc(var(--number-size) * -1);-webkit-transform:none;transform:none}.wp-block-acf-numbered-features.is-style-default .item .image,.wp-block-acf-numbered-features:not([class*=is-style-]) .item .image{position:relative}.wp-block-acf-numbered-features.is-style-default .item .image img,.wp-block-acf-numbered-features:not([class*=is-style-]) .item .image img{position:absolute;top:0;left:0}.wp-block-acf-numbered-features.is-style-default .item:nth-child(odd),.wp-block-acf-numbered-features:not([class*=is-style-]) .item:nth-child(odd){background-image:-webkit-gradient(linear,left top,right top,color-stop(51%,var(--color-bg)),color-stop(51%,transparent));background-image:linear-gradient(to right,var(--color-bg) 51%,transparent 51%)}.wp-block-acf-numbered-features.is-style-default .item:nth-child(odd) .content,.wp-block-acf-numbered-features:not([class*=is-style-]) .item:nth-child(odd) .content{-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1;padding-left:0}.wp-block-acf-numbered-features.is-style-default .item:nth-child(odd) .content:before,.wp-block-acf-numbered-features:not([class*=is-style-]) .item:nth-child(odd) .content:before{margin-right:auto}.wp-block-acf-numbered-features.is-style-default .item:nth-child(odd) .image,.wp-block-acf-numbered-features:not([class*=is-style-]) .item:nth-child(odd) .image{-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2}.wp-block-acf-numbered-features.is-style-default .item:nth-child(odd) .image img,.wp-block-acf-numbered-features:not([class*=is-style-]) .item:nth-child(odd) .image img{border-radius:0 var(--border-radius) var(--border-radius) 0}.wp-block-acf-numbered-features.is-style-default .item:nth-child(2n),.wp-block-acf-numbered-features:not([class*=is-style-]) .item:nth-child(2n){background-image:-webkit-gradient(linear,left top,right top,color-stop(49%,transparent),color-stop(49%,var(--color-bg)));background-image:linear-gradient(to right,transparent 49%,var(--color-bg) 49%)}.wp-block-acf-numbered-features.is-style-default .item:nth-child(2n) .content,.wp-block-acf-numbered-features:not([class*=is-style-]) .item:nth-child(2n) .content{-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2;padding-right:0}.wp-block-acf-numbered-features.is-style-default .item:nth-child(2n) .content:before,.wp-block-acf-numbered-features:not([class*=is-style-]) .item:nth-child(2n) .content:before{margin-left:auto}.wp-block-acf-numbered-features.is-style-default .item:nth-child(2n) .image,.wp-block-acf-numbered-features:not([class*=is-style-]) .item:nth-child(2n) .image{-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1}.wp-block-acf-numbered-features.is-style-default .item:nth-child(2n) .image img,.wp-block-acf-numbered-features:not([class*=is-style-]) .item:nth-child(2n) .image img{border-radius:var(--border-radius) 0 0 var(--border-radius)}}.wp-block-acf-numbered-features.is-style-pattern2 .items{padding-top:clamp(1.5rem,3vw,2rem);display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;row-gap:clamp(3rem,5vw,4rem)}.wp-block-acf-numbered-features.is-style-pattern2 .item{padding-left:var(--wp--style--root--padding-left);padding-right:var(--wp--style--root--padding-right)}.wp-block-acf-numbered-features.is-style-pattern2 .item .wrapper{position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.wp-block-acf-numbered-features.is-style-pattern2 .item .wrapper:before{content:counter(features-count,decimal-leading-zero);display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;font-family:"Libre Baskerville","Aboreto","Noto Serif JP",sans-serif;position:absolute;top:0;left:var(--padding-x);padding:0;font-size:var(--number-size);font-weight:normal;color:var(--wp--preset--color--primary);line-height:1;-webkit-transform:translateY(-50%);transform:translateY(-50%);text-shadow:0 0 0.5rem rgba(255,255,255,0.8)}.wp-block-acf-numbered-features.is-style-pattern2 .item .content{-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;row-gap:clamp(1.3rem,3vw,1.8rem);padding:var(--padding-y) var(--padding-x);background-color:var(--color-bg);border-radius:0 0 var(--border-radius) var(--border-radius)}.wp-block-acf-numbered-features.is-style-pattern2 .item .content .title{font-size:clamp(1.2rem,2vw,1.8rem);color:var(--wp--preset--color--primary)}.wp-block-acf-numbered-features.is-style-pattern2 .item .image{-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1}.wp-block-acf-numbered-features.is-style-pattern2 .item .image img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;aspect-ratio:16/9;border-radius:var(--border-radius) var(--border-radius) 0 0}@media screen and (min-width:851px){.wp-block-acf-numbered-features.is-style-pattern2 .items{display:-ms-grid;display:grid;-ms-grid-columns:1fr clamp(2rem,6vw,5rem) 1fr;grid-template-columns:1fr 1fr;gap:clamp(2rem,6vw,5rem)}.wp-block-acf-numbered-features.is-style-pattern2 .item{padding:0}.wp-block-acf-numbered-features.is-style-pattern2 .item .image img{aspect-ratio:initial}.wp-block-acf-numbered-features.is-style-pattern2 .item:first-child{grid-column:1/-1;background-image:-webkit-gradient(linear,left top,right top,color-stop(51%,var(--color-bg)),color-stop(51%,var(--color-bg)));background-image:linear-gradient(to right,var(--color-bg) 51%,var(--color-bg) 51%)}.wp-block-acf-numbered-features.is-style-pattern2 .item:first-child .wrapper{display:-ms-grid;display:grid;-ms-grid-columns:1fr 1fr;grid-template-columns:1fr 1fr}.wp-block-acf-numbered-features.is-style-pattern2 .item:first-child .content{-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1}.wp-block-acf-numbered-features.is-style-pattern2 .item:first-child .image{-webkit-box-ordinal-group:3;-ms-flex-order:2;order:2}.wp-block-acf-numbered-features.is-style-pattern2 .item:first-child .image img{border-radius:0}.wp-block-acf-numbered-features.is-style-pattern2 .item:not(:first-child):nth-child(2n) .image img{border-radius:0 var(--border-radius) 0 0}.wp-block-acf-numbered-features.is-style-pattern2 .item:not(:first-child):nth-child(2n) .content{border-radius:0 0 var(--border-radius) 0}.wp-block-acf-numbered-features.is-style-pattern2 .item:not(:first-child):nth-child(odd) .image img{border-radius:var(--border-radius) 0 0}.wp-block-acf-numbered-features.is-style-pattern2 .item:not(:first-child):nth-child(odd) .content{border-radius:0 0 0 var(--border-radius)}}